sue58 Posted June 19, 2014 #5 Share Posted June 19, 2014 I did the Summit cruise to Bermuda on June 1 and also needed transportation from the port to EWR. When you get off the ship, get your luggage, go through immigration and then go outside you will have choices. Turn right to go towards the ship provided shuttles which were about $28 per person - you can buy transfers on the ship during your cruise. If you turn left when you exit you will be walking towards awaiting taxis. Before you get to the taxis there is an area where you can get a shuttle to the airport - that is what I used. I hadn't prearranged anything before I got off the ship. The cost of this shuttle was $16 per person, which was paid to the driver once you got to the airport. The shuttles were vans and there were 8 of us in the van I was in. The driver dropped each of us off at whichever terminal we needed. I was very happy with this service and would definitely use it again.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

sandav Posted June 19, 2014 #8 Share Posted June 19, 2014 My husband and myself have just returned from Summit cruise to Bermuda. We took a Celebrity transfer. It was $28 each. We purchased the transfer while on board. The bus was over to the right as you leave the terminal building . The dispatcher checks your name off the list. The driver puts your luggage in the section for the terminal you are using and drops you off at the terminal you want. . It was very simple. We left the ship around 8.30 but the bus didn't leave till after 9am. We had a great cruise. Bermuda is lovely and very user friendly.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Pushkin Posted June 20, 2014 #9 Share Posted June 20, 2014 We just returned from our Summit cruise on Sunday (6/15/14). After exiting the building, turn left for the taxi area. There are also shuttles to the airport. My sister and her husband took shuttle at $15/pp. We took "taxi" (5 of us) and the fare was $75. So I guess that works out to be the same price. I'm not from NY area, but $75 for a 15 min taxi ride seems high. What was odd, was that although the vehicle had "taxi" on the outside, there was no indication on the inside that it was a taxi (no meter, no sign, no taxi number, no number to call if you have problems). Also, the driver had no badge, name tag or other identifying info on her. Just seemed odd. To give those not from the area an idea of taxi costs, the first taxi trip was from the Amtrak station (Penn Station, I believe) to our hotel (near airport) -- that one was $65. Then, we used Independent Driver from the hotel to the port (7 of us) and that was $85. Then, the last trip -- from the port to EWR was $75. Definitely more than us midwesterners are used to! OP you can also exit the terminal and turn left and walk towards the taxi line...the dispatcher will put you in a van/cab (possibly with others ) going to the airport for less than the $28 that the cruise line charges...IIRC it's about 15-16 PP... Getting there is not too bad and there will be many people doing the same thing. The cruise line transfers are more expensive but not totally out of line with the pricing...however, you may be waiting longer than if you go left toward the other taxis/vans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
